When I finished and saved my weekly devotional, I hit the space bar for no particular reason and the file disappeared. I was using the Microsoft Works Word processor. 15,OOO KB were showing in the filelist, but I couldn't open the file. I then opened Open Office and the same thing happened again, except that I could bring it back with Ctrl-Z.
I finally finished the file by saving and renaming the file about 8 times, but it didn't happen again. I had forgotten that I had to retype the devotional last week, also.
Anyone have any ideas?

Quote:
In my experience Open Office opens most word files and edits thm fine .. but I have seen issues where the saved doc didn't open on the other end correctly when converted back to MS Office. So it depends a bit on needs.
Rharv, I experienced that exact problem this past Friday. OO saved a Word document in a newer format than the recipient's copy of MS Word and, consequently, she couldn't open it until I re-sent it in an older Word format. OO will emulate most Word documents but it requires knowing which version of Word the recipient is running.
